Comprehending Flameproof Systems: A Detailed Guide
Illustrating flameproof lighting requires any rudimentary apprehension of threatening areas. These locations, often found in industrial plants, contain combustible vapors or dust that may ignite readily. Explosion-proof lighting apparatus are precisely designed to counter ignition by locking in electrical assemblies within an sealed box that is constructed to absorb an inward flare-up without letting out it to the outside atmosphere. This enables safety in inherently dangerous environments, offering trouble-free illumination.
Electing the Appropriate Certified Devices for Risky Zones
Identifying matching safe light devices for any hazardous area is imperatively crucial for security incidents. Careful inspection has to be given to aspects such like the determined standard (e.g., Class I, Division 1), the category of gases contained, and the climatic heat. Omitting these elements can create serious impacts, necessitating proper designation essential.

Where are Do Blast-Proof Devices Compulsory? Controlled Sectors Presented
Protected light sources are critical for protecting personnel and equipment in environments containing hazardous atmospheres. These zones, classified according to standards like NEC and ATEX, dictate where these lighting solutions must be established. Generally, Zone 0 (or equivalent) represents a territory where explosive atmospheres are incessantly present, demanding peak level of protection. Zone 1 (or equivalent) signifies a suspected explosive atmosphere, while Zone 2 (or equivalent) indicates a moderate danger. Common locations requesting explosion-proof lamps consist of refining plants, gas refineries, flour handling facilities, paint booths, and industrial water treatment plants. Persistently adhere to local norms and rulesets to properly determine the suitable level of protection.
